Is It Safe to Mix Water and Milk?
For most healthy adults, adding a small amount of water to milk is not a health risk. The most significant consequence is the dilution of the milk's nutritional content, including protein, fat, and calcium. However, there are different considerations depending on who is drinking the milk, the quality of the water, and the purpose of the dilution.
Potential Health Effects of Diluted Milk
- Reduced Nutrient Density: Diluting milk lowers the concentration of essential nutrients per serving. A cup of half-water, half-milk will provide half the calories and vitamins compared to a cup of pure milk.
- Easier Digestion: For some individuals with mild lactose sensitivity, diluting milk can make it easier on the stomach by reducing the concentration of lactose. It's a common practice for older adults or those who find pure milk too heavy.
- Hydration: Diluted milk can be a way to increase fluid intake, particularly in warm weather or for people who don't enjoy plain water. It still provides electrolytes like potassium and sodium, which aid in hydration.
- Taste and Texture: The most immediate and noticeable effect is the change in taste and texture. Diluted milk will have a less rich, thinner consistency and a milder flavor.
The Critical Danger for Infants
It is critically important to understand that mixing extra water with infant formula is extremely dangerous and can be fatal. Infants have tiny kidneys that cannot process large amounts of water. Excess water dilutes their electrolyte levels, leading to a condition called water intoxication, which can cause seizures, brain damage, and death. Always follow the manufacturer's instructions precisely when preparing infant formula.

Potential Risks and Food Safety Concerns
While deliberate dilution by a consumer might be for personal health or convenience, food safety issues arise when milk is adulterated by producers for illicit gain. This is illegal in most countries and poses significant health risks. Adulterated milk can contain unsafe tap water, which introduces harmful bacteria, reducing its shelf life and causing illness.
What to Know About Adulterated Milk
- Test for water: The Food Safety and Standards Authority of India (FSSAI) suggests a simple at-home test for water adulteration. A drop of pure milk on a slanted surface will leave a white trail, whereas diluted milk will run quickly without a visible trail.
- Check for other chemicals: Beyond water, unscrupulous vendors might add detergents, starch, or other chemicals to thicken the milk and mask the dilution.
- Purchasing tips: Always buy milk from reputable, licensed sources to ensure it meets quality and safety standards.

How To Test Milk Purity At Home
To test if milk has been adulterated with water, you can perform a simple at-home test. This method is recommended by authorities like the FSSAI. Take a clean, polished, and slanted surface like a plate or glass slide. Pour a drop of the milk slowly down the surface. Pure, undiluted milk will flow slowly, leaving a distinct, white, milky trail behind it. If the milk has been watered down, it will flow quickly and leave a very faint or transparent trail, as the water reduces the viscosity and surface tension.
